Wear Resistant Tool

  • Wear resistant tools play an important part in manufacturing processes such as chemical fibers, processed food, automobiles, and communication equipment.

    Deformation processing tools, which process rolling and drawing, and shearing and forging of metals, and wear resistant parts for industrial use must resist long-time use in processing.
    It has to withstand dissolving metals with intense heat, and all the other external pressures such as acid, corrosion, impact, and abrasion.

    It requires manufacturing technology and selection and design of tool material which withstands the abrasion. We handle parts of the wear resistant tools such as carbide, ceramics, high-speed steel, die steel and surface treatment such as coating, and nitriding.
